Source: bbpager
Version: 0.4.7-3
Severity: serious

>From my pbuilder build log:

...
x86_64-linux-gnu-g++  -Wall -g -O2  -I/usr/include/bt
-I/usr/include/freetype2  -s   -lSM -lICE -lX11 -o bbpager  bbpager.o
main.o Baseresource.o resource.o wminterface.o pager.o desktop.o
-lXext -lbt -fPIE -pie -Wl,-z,relro -Wl,-z,now
/usr/bin/ld: bbpager.o: relocation R_X86_64_32S against symbol
`_ZTV10ToolWindow' can not be used when making a shared object;
recompile with -fPIC
/usr/bin/ld: main.o: relocation R_X86_64_32 against `.rodata.str1.8'
can not be used when making a shared object; recompile with -fPIC
/usr/bin/ld: Baseresource.o: relocation R_X86_64_32S against symbol
`_ZTV12BaseResource' can not be used when making a shared object;
recompile with -fPIC
/usr/bin/ld: resource.o: relocation R_X86_64_32 against
`.rodata.str1.8' can not be used when making a shared object;
recompile with -fPIC
/usr/bin/ld: wminterface.o: relocation R_X86_64_32S against symbol
`_ZTV11WMInterface' can not be used when making a shared object;
recompile with -fPIC
/usr/bin/ld: pager.o: relocation R_X86_64_32S against symbol
`_ZTV11PagerWindow' can not be used when making a shared object;
recompile with -fPIC
/usr/bin/ld: desktop.o: relocation R_X86_64_32S against symbol
`_ZTV13DesktopWindow' can not be used when making a shared object;
recompile with -fPIC
/usr/bin/ld: final link failed: Nonrepresentable section on output
collect2: error: ld returned 1 exit status
Makefile:241: recipe for target 'bbpager' failed
make[3]: *** [bbpager] Error 1
make[3]: Leaving directory '/build/bbpager-0.4.7/src'
Makefile:235: recipe for target 'all-recursive' failed
make[2]: *** [all-recursive] Error 1
make[2]: Leaving directory '/build/bbpager-0.4.7'
Makefile:173: recipe for target 'all' failed
make[1]: *** [all] Error 2
make[1]: Leaving directory '/build/bbpager-0.4.7'
debian/rules:19: recipe for target 'build-stamp' failed
make: *** [build-stamp] Error 2
dpkg-buildpackage: error: debian/rules build gave error exit status 2

Changes:
 bbpager (0.4.7-4) unstable; urgency=medium
 .
   * Added compiler flag -fPIC to debian/rules to address FTBFS bug.
     Closes: #835034.
   * debian/rules:
     + Added appropriate changes to debian/rules to remove dpatch calls in favor
       of quilt.
     + Added include call to quilt.
     + Updated dh_clean -k to dh_prep.
     + Added build commands to build-arch build-indep.
     + Added dh_clean command to unpatch.
   * Switched to dpkg-source 3.0 (quilt) format. Added debian/source/format
     file.
   * debian/control:
     + Added quilt to Build-Depends and removed dpatch.
     + Bumped Standards-Version to 3.9.8. No changes.
     + debhelper version bumped to 9.
   * Updated debian/compat to version 9.
